A to Z Pet Shop Introduce
For pet lovers across Connecticut, finding a pet store that aligns with your values and provides a high level of care is a top priority. A to Z Pet Shop, a local, women-owned small business in Derby, aims to be that trusted destination for everything from pet supplies to finding a new animal companion. This shop prides itself on being a part of the local community, offering a personal touch that you often don’t find in larger, corporate chains. The store is known for its wide array of pets and pet supplies, and according to some customers, the animals are "so cute and well taken care of." They welcome visitors to interact with some of the animals, such as bunnies and ferrets, which adds a unique, hands-on element to the shopping experience. A to Z Pet Shop's focus on connecting pets with their forever homes is a central part of their identity.
However, it is essential for prospective pet owners to be aware of the complexities involved in purchasing an animal, especially puppies, from any pet store. While some customers have had positive experiences, praising the staff and the care of the animals, other reviews have raised serious concerns about the health of the puppies sold. Multiple customer accounts detail tragic experiences with puppies that were diagnosed with serious health issues shortly after being brought home, including parasites, malnutrition, and congenital conditions like megaesophagus. These customers assert that these issues were present at the time of sale and point to a larger problem of neglect or poor breeding practices. While the store has a health guarantee and may offer reimbursement, the emotional and financial toll on families who have gone through these experiences is significant. It is a stark reminder for potential buyers to exercise extreme caution, ask detailed questions, and be prepared to take immediate action if health problems arise.

The services at A to Z Pet Shop are centered around providing for the basic needs of a pet owner, from finding a new animal to getting the necessary supplies.
- Pet Sales: A to Z Pet Shop sells a variety of animals, including puppies, kittens, birds, reptiles, small animals, and fish. They are dedicated to finding a forever home for every animal.
- Pet Supplies: The store offers a wide selection of pet supplies, including food, treats, toys, bedding, cages, and other essentials for various types of pets.
- Onsite Services: Customers can benefit from onsite services, which include being able to interact with certain animals like bunnies and ferrets, as mentioned in a customer review.
- Veterinarian Care: According to the business's own information, a veterinarian visits the store weekly to examine every animal. They state that if a pet is under the weather, the situation will be addressed on the spot.
- Pet Food Programs: The store offers frequent buyer programs for various brands of pet food, providing a benefit for loyal customers.

I have been grieving for months after buying a puppy from here that passed away. I finally have the strength to tell her story.I bought a 3 month old french bulldog from A to Z Pet Shop exactly a year ago from today (February 23, 2024). She threw up a little upon bringing her home. We kept an eye on her and hoped that maybe it was just nervousness of being in a new environment.The next day, she continued throwing up, but this time there was blood. We rushed her to the ER. It was discovered that she had 2 strains of parasites: giardia and cystoisopora and was diagnosed with congenital megaesophagus and had pink eye that needed to be treated. She also weighed 5.9 pounds when she needed to be at least 10 pounds to be considered healthy weight. She was so lethargic and dehydrated and was seen several times by the ER. We were told by the ER and her primary care that we may need to consider euthanization options because of how sick and little she was. We fought to keep her alive. The ER bill came out to thousands of dollars. We got on the phone with Tara, the owner to A to Z. She said sorry, but there was nothing she could do for us. Luckily, my boyfriend at the time was going through the documents and found the A to Z Pet Shop Health Guarantee that states each puppy is guaranteed from any illness for 20 days. There's also a lemon law that protects people in these situations. That got Tara's attention to work with us!We went with the reimbursement option (for us to keep Chia and for them to reimburse us for the ER bills) because we loved Chia and wanted to care for her.Unfortunately, Chia had to be on a lot of medications so she could live a normal life due to how sickly she was when we bought her. She wasn't able to develop a strong immune system during the time she needed to and it took a toll on her. Her health was in waves throughout the several months we had her and ultimately, her body could not take it any longer.We loved and cared for her deeply. She is always our baby in our hearts.
